| Guidelines |
Interns at Metro Parks Tacoma serve without compensation, unless:
- The candidate is a work study student.
- There is a cooperative agreement with the educational institution to directly pay the school a payment on behalf of the student.
These options can be discussed between the MPT Internship Coordinator, Intern Candidate, and Education Institution Advisor.

Internship Opportunities
You know the dilemma: You can't get a good job without experience, and you can't get experience without a good job.
You've come to the right place. Metro Parks Tacoma offers a variety of internships designed to give you meaningful, supportive, rewarding and fun work as you gain experience in the real world. As a municipal park district, we provide internship opportunities in the following areas:
- Aquatics/Swimming Pool Management
- Art Education & Outreach Program
- Community Events
- Fitness & Wellness Community Education
- Fort Nisqually Curator
- Fort Nisqually Education
- Golf Course Operations
- Governmental Relations
- Green House Horticulture Gardening
- Landscape & Garden Design
- Lincoln Center Enrichment Program
- Marketing & Outreach
- NYSA - Northwest Youth Sports Alliance
- Outdoor Adventures
- Parks Administration/Open Space
- Planning & Design
- Resource Development
- SPARX Middle School After School Program
- Specialized Recreation
- Summer Playground Activity & Event
- Tacoma Nature Center Education/Naturalist
- Point Defiance Zoo
- Northwest Trek
